  • This is something I've been working on for the past few weeks ever since I learned that ELRS is including Wi-Fi-based joystick support in ELRS 3.4. I got onto this a bit late, so I'm paying catch up a little.
    It was working on the desktop pretty quickly, but when actually testing on a real iPhone I had to fundamentally change the way it worked - twice! Anyway, this should be coming out soon(ish) along with support for Tracer/Crossfire modules.
    It was actually the Velocidrone folks that pushed this idea through - so props (pun intended) to them for the idea!
